Activated Carbon Micron Powder – 4000 µm (4 mm)
Our Activated Carbon Micron Powder with a particle size of 4000 µm (4 mm) is a coarse-grade adsorbent ideal for demanding filtration and purification systems. Thanks to its extremely high surface area and robust physical properties, it is widely used in industrial processes where deep bed filtration, low-pressure drop, and extended service life are essential.
Key Technical Specifications:
Particle Size (ASTM D2862): 4000 µm (4 mm)
Specific Surface Area (BET, N₂ method): 1050 m²/g
Bulk Density (ASTM D2854): 440–480 kg/m³
Ash Content (ASTM D2866): ≤ 12%
Iodine Number (AWWA B604): ≥ 1000 mg/g
Moisture Content (ASTM D2867): ≤ 5%
Hardness (ASTM D3802): ≥ 95
CAS Number: 7440-44-0

Applications:
Industrial Water & Wastewater Treatment:
Optimal for use in granular activated carbon filters designed to handle large particulate sizes in high-volume treatment systems.Air and Vapor Phase Filtration:
Provides effective control of volatile organic compounds (VOCs), hydrogen sulfide, and industrial odors in both open and closed-loop systems.Food and Beverage Processing:
Ideal for purification and deodorization processes in edible oil refining, sugar syrup processing, and beverage filtration.Gold Recovery:
Preferred in carbon-in-pulp (CIP) and carbon-in-leach (CIL) systems due to its coarse structure and superior adsorption properties.Gas Purification & Chemical Processing:
Serves as an adsorbent and catalyst support in petrochemical and refining operations requiring thermal stability and high surface activity.Aquarium and Aquaculture Filtration:
Efficiently removes toxins and organic waste, maintaining clear, healthy aquatic environments.
